Saffron extract is rich in antioxidants like crocin, crocetin, safranal, and kaempferol which help protect cells from damage caused by free radicals.
Studies suggest that saffron extract may help improve mood and reduce symptoms of depression and anxiety.
Saffron extract has been shown to help suppress appetite and reduce cravings, which may aid in weight management.
Research indicates that saffron extract may have positive effects on memory and cognitive function, potentially benefiting individuals with age-related cognitive decline.
Saffron extract possesses anti-inflammatory properties that may help reduce inflammation in the body and alleviate symptoms of conditions like arthritis.

Make sure to select a reputable brand that offers pure Saffron Extract without any fillers or additives.
Consult the product label or your healthcare provider to determine the correct dosage for your needs. Typically, the recommended dosage is around 30 mg per day.
It is best to take Saffron Extract with a meal to enhance its absorption.
For optimal results, it is important to take Saffron Extract consistently every day.
Give it time to work. Saffron Extract may take a few weeks to show its full effects.
Pay attention to how your body responds to Saffron Extract. If you experience any unusual symptoms, discontinue use and consult a healthcare professional.

When comparing Saffron Extract with similar products, it is important to consider the unique properties and benefits of each supplement.
Saffron Extract is derived from the saffron crocus flower and is known for its potential health benefits, including mood enhancement, appetite suppression, and antioxidant properties. It is often used as a natural remedy for various health conditions.
Turmeric is a spice that contains the active compound curcumin, known for its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. It is commonly used to support joint health, reduce inflammation, and boost overall immunity.
Rhodiola Rosea is an adaptogenic herb that helps the body adapt to stress and promotes overall well-being. It is often used to improve mental performance, reduce fatigue, and enhance physical endurance.
Ashwagandha is an ancient medicinal herb known for its ability to reduce stress, improve cognitive function, and boost energy levels. It is commonly used to support adrenal health and promote a sense of calmness.
While Saffron Extract offers unique benefits such as mood enhancement and appetite suppression, it is important to consider individual health goals and consult with a healthcare professional before incorporating any new supplement into your routine.

While saffron extract is known for its various health benefits, there are other natural products that can offer similar effects. One such alternative is Turmeric Extract.
Turmeric contains a compound called curcumin, which has powerful an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. It has been used in traditional medicine for centuries and has been studied extensively for its health benefits.
According to the maker of WebMD, turmeric extract can help with conditions such as arthritis, heart disease, and digestive issues. It may also have potential benefits for brain health and cancer prevention.
Adding turmeric extract to your daily routine can be a great way to support your overall health and well-being as an alternative to saffron extract.
